C# Class numl.Reinforcement.QLearning.QLearnerGenerator

Q-Learner generator.
Inheritance: ReinforcementGenerator
Afficher le fichier Open project: sethjuarez/numl

Méthodes publiques

Méthode Description
Generate ( Matrix X1, Vector y, Matrix X2, Vector r ) : IReinforcementModel

Generates a QLearnerModel based on states/actions with transitions and rewards.

QLearnerGenerator ( ) : System

Initializes a new QLearnerGenerator object.

Method Details

Generate() public méthode

Generates a QLearnerModel based on states/actions with transitions and rewards.
public Generate ( Matrix X1, Vector y, Matrix X2, Vector r ) : IReinforcementModel
X1 Matrix Initial State matrix.
y numl.Math.LinearAlgebra.Vector Action label vector.
X2 Matrix Transition State matrix.
r numl.Math.LinearAlgebra.Vector Reward values.
Résultat IReinforcementModel

QLearnerGenerator() public méthode

Initializes a new QLearnerGenerator object.
public QLearnerGenerator ( ) : System
Résultat System